Transaction 7147ef040512f5935de630c2369697043c48b4ccb7fd794524ae34539e55670b
3 Input
2 Outputs
- 7147ef040512f5935de630c2369697043c48b4ccb7fd794524ae34539e55670b:0
- 7147ef040512f5935de630c2369697043c48b4ccb7fd794524ae34539e55670b:1
value 19409
address 12AH4zX2tsTgsVuPSh9MmePNwkTXTyYdCQ
value 1498948
address 1G6FcwJtv8M3KkYx6Pr8PVQDLehEF93tPz